I'm in the process of taking a blown 1993 Bronco 5.0 motor, taking all the fuel injection, accessories, etc, and putting them on a 302 from a 1979 Mustang Pace Car (1978 engine in all reality). The last hitch I've ran into is the distributor gear. I know that they're bothmadeout of different material and need to swap them but the dist. shaft that I'm using from the '93 is larger and the dist. gear on the 78 motor is smaller. What part do I need so that I can use the 93 distributor (I have to) with the 1978 engine using the 78 cam?

Stick it in, if it fits it works orgo to a parts store and have them pull both distributers, if the gear size is the same and has the same number of teeth and the install depth is the same then it will work.

What about the material that the gears are made of? I know that you need a bronze gear to run on a steel cam or roller cam, but will it hurt to run a bronze gear on a cast cam? That's the issue, it fits, it's just a matter if the metals will be compatible.</P>
